Warning.....Just a heads up if you are not aware of this.  Be very careful that you do not purchase a phone or air card from Verizon at a discount.  Once you do that, they put you on a new plan and you will loose your unlimited data plan.  The only way, that I know of, to keep you grandfathered into the unlimited data plan is to purchase the phone or device outright.  It can be from Verizon, but you will pay retail.  If you do not have to have the latest and greatest phone, then I would try eBay.  Had to do that last year but needed a smart phone so close to $600 bucks.  The positive side of things is that I can stream video while traveling using 4G internet and a Roku box and never have to worry about the data plan.  My guess is that if you have unlimited on the air card, this will not impact your phone plan but you probably want to make sure.  They obviously want to get you off of the unlimited plans if they can.

I got a Razr 4g phone off of Craigslist for $200 a couple of years ago.  I bought it to be my backup phone.  Verizon told me to call in the SN & IMEI number and make the free call to Verizon to verify that it's not stolen and can be activated.  Now that I have that phone I play games, use it's clock and alarm features, and when my phone breaks, I just put my SIM card in it and I'm good to go.  Once I get my phone fixed, I put the SIM card back and all is well with the world.  I use my phone for business, and business stops without a phone, that's why it was worth having.  I found Galaxy Note 3 unlocked phones for under $200 on the DFW craigslist.
